Intended use
The product serves as a camera that can transmit the captured image over a USB connection to a PC.
Thanks to the integrated lens, particularly small objects/surfaces can be magnifi ed and imaged. The power
is supplied via a USB port. The camera has an additional polarizing fi lter, which fi lters out annoying light
infl uences (for example refl ections from the device being tested).

Driver/Software Installation
Operating and applications software are subject to constant change through updates. For this
reason, not all eventualities but only the basic software installation can be shown in this guide.
• Start your operating system. Place the CD included in the delivery in an appropriate drive on your computer.
• The software now starts automatically and you can install the software. If the CD does not start automati-
cally, start the installation program on the CD manually (the root directory of the CD, for example, "autorun.
exe" or similar). Follow all the software instructions.
On the desktop of your computer a new fl ow pattern symbol is created. Now connect the microscope camera
to a free USB 2.0 port on your computer. The operating system recognises the new hardware and completes
the driver installation. Note any information from the manufacturer which is present on the CD.
• Start by double clicking the newly created fl ow pattern symbol of the software.
• Click the button "Settings" to make the basic settings of the software for "image resolution, image adjust-
ment, selection of USB camera, etc".
• With the computer keyboard or by clicking on "Capture", you can choose whether to take an image (keyboard
"F4"), a video (keyboard "F8") or a timed variation of an image or video (keyboard "F5").
• A "Click here" symbol should appear. Here you will be asked to use test recordings to create a reference
(Calibration – for example with graph paper or the calibration template from the original packaged product)
for later messages and displays. To do this, follow the instructions in the English "Help File". If you only
want to look at the topics, you can ignore this message.

Operation
www.conrad.com
• The LED lights in the front lens can be switched off with the slide switch (3) (button position OFF) or two
brightness levels can be selected (button positions "1" and "2").
• Move the lens (1) of the microscope camera as close as possible to the desired object (e. g. place the front

on a newspaper).
• Adjust the picture until the image is sharp by using the adjustment dial (2).
• The camera has additionally a so-called polarizing fi lter. You can improve the image reproduction for
objects with a highly refl ective surface by switching the illumination to level 1 (half brightness) and turning
the adjustment ring (7) to fade down the refl ection or at least reduce it.
• Turn the microscope camera or the object to be viewed until the picture is aligned as desired.
• The microscope camera can be fi xed at a given position using the table stand included in the delivery; the
locking bolt (5) fi xes the position of the table stand.
• Button (4) on top of the microscope camera is used to control the camera function of the software.

Cleaning
Check the lens of the microscope camera occasionally, clean it of dust and dirt. Use an appropriate lens
cleaning system, e. g. a clean, soft brush. Do not press too hard on the optics/mechanics of the camera,
since it may be damaged. Furthermore, you may cause scratch marks on the lens.

Technical Data
Sensor .........................................3488 x 2616 Pixel (9 MP)
USB Connection ..........................USB2.0
Operating voltage ........................5 V= (via USB)
Lighting ........................................8 white LEDs
Magnifi cation ...............................Max. approx. 200x
Focus range .................................10 mm to 200 mm
Dimensions (W x L) .....................approx. 37 x 140 mm
